Hospitality Center, Orlando, FL Guía Local

¿Cuánto cuesta alquilar un apartamento en Hospitality Center?
| Dormitorios | Precio Promedio | Más barato | Más caro |
|---|---|---|---|
| Apartamentos Estudio en Hospitality Center | $1,295 | $995 | $2,034 |
| Apartamentos 1 Dormitorios en Hospitality Center | $1,826 | $706 | $2,805 |
| Apartamentos 2 Dormitorios en Hospitality Center | $2,238 | $846 | $3,425 |
| Apartamentos 3 Dormitorios en Hospitality Center | $2,488 | $1,399 | $9,168 |
| Apartamentos 4 Dormitorios en Hospitality Center | $3,810 | $1,675 | $10,000+ |

Preguntas frecuentes sobre Hospitality Center
¿Cuánto cuestan los apartamentos estudio en Hospitality Center?
Actualmente hay 19 Apartamentos Estudios en Hospitality Center con alquileres que van desde $995 hasta $2,034, con un precio medio de $1,295.
¿Cuál es el rango actual de precios de los apartamentos de alquiler de un dormitorio en Hospitality Center?
A día de hoy el precio de Apartamentos 1 Dormitorio en Hospitality Center varian entre $706 y $2,805 con un alquiler mensual promedio de $1,826
¿Cuánto cuesta alquilar un apartamento de dos dormitorios en Hospitality Center?
El precio mensual de alquiler de Apartamentos 2 Dormitorios disponibles en Hospitality Center van desde $846 hasta $3,425. Actualmente el precio medio de un alquiler de dos dormitorios aquí es de $2,238
¿Qué tan caros son los apartamentos de tres dormitorios en Hospitality Center?
En estos momentos hay 65 Apartamentos 3 Dormitorios disponibles en Hospitality Center en ApartmentHomeLiving.com, los precio oscilan entre $1,399 y $9,168 - con una media de $2,488 para el lugar.
